Transaction 8502b32158b691d92544f77fc4a179b5320039037d57d10000da3830b54ca252
1 Input
1 Output
-
8502b32158b691d92544f77fc4a179b5320039037d57d10000da3830b54ca252:0
- value
- 91160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d5dab7d509fc604b2b18e2dab2c36a2dcbad186 OP_EQUAL
- address
- 3G36DxYprg8KB2o6TzWawiGr8bkgTZAR6L